A Architecture Design, uma capability dentro da macro capability Enterprise Architecture e da camada Technology Visioning, desempenha um papel essencial na garantia de que a infraestrutura tecnológica de uma organização seja sólida, eficiente e alinhada com suas metas e objetivos.
No contexto do CIO Codex Capability Framework, as melhores práticas de mercado que são amplamente reconhecidas e aplicadas incluem:
· Alinhamento Estratégico: A principal melhor prática é assegurar que o design arquitetônico esteja em total conformidade com a estratégia de negócios da organização. Isso é alcançado por meio de uma análise rigorosa das necessidades de TI em relação aos objetivos da empresa, garantindo que cada componente da arquitetura contribua diretamente para o sucesso organizacional.
· Detalhamento Preciso: A precisão é crucial no processo de Architecture Design. Isso implica na criação de planos altamente detalhados que definem cada aspecto da solução de TI. Essa prática ajuda a evitar surpresas indesejadas durante a implementação e contribui para a entrega bem-sucedida de projetos.
· Integração de Componentes Eficiente: Uma abordagem de design eficaz considera como os diferentes elementos tecnológicos se integrarão para formar uma solução coesa. A prática de projetar uma integração eficiente é fundamental para evitar problemas de interoperabilidade e garantir o funcionamento suave de sistemas complexos.
· Robustez e Resiliência: Projetar soluções robustas e resilientes é uma prática essencial. Isso significa que as arquiteturas devem ser capazes de lidar com cargas de trabalho intensas e resistir a falhas de maneira eficaz. A resiliência é fundamental para manter a continuidade dos negócios, mesmo em situações adversas.
· Escalabilidade Adequada: Considerar a escalabilidade desde o início é outra prática importante. Isso envolve o planejamento para que a solução possa crescer e se adaptar às crescentes demandas do ambiente tecnológico e de negócios. A escalabilidade garante que a solução permaneça eficaz no longo prazo.
· Eficiência Operacional: A otimização de recursos é uma consideração crítica. Isso inclui minimizar custos, maximizar o desempenho e garantir o uso eficiente de recursos, como hardware, software e pessoal de TI.
· Segurança Integrada: A segurança deve ser incorporada desde o início do processo de design arquitetônico. Isso envolve a identificação de medidas de segurança apropriadas para proteger a solução contra ameaças cibernéticas. A segurança é um componente crítico de qualquer arquitetura de TI.
· Avaliação Contínua: A prática de avaliação contínua é crucial. Isso implica em monitorar o desempenho da solução após a implementação e realizar ajustes conforme necessário para garantir que ela continue a atender às necessidades da organização ao longo do tempo.
· Documentação Abundante: A criação de documentação abrangente é uma prática recomendada para garantir a compreensão e a manutenção adequada da arquitetura. Isso inclui diagramas, especificações técnicas e manuais de operação.
· Revisão por Pares: Realizar revisões por pares é uma prática importante para garantir a qualidade do design arquitetônico. Isso envolve a análise crítica do design por colegas de trabalho ou especialistas para identificar possíveis melhorias ou problemas.
Essas melhores práticas de mercado são amplamente reconhecidas como fundamentais para o sucesso da capability de Architecture Design.
Elas contribuem para a entrega de soluções de TI eficientes, robustas e alinhadas com os objetivos estratégicos da organização.
Ao adotar essas práticas, as empresas podem fortalecer sua infraestrutura tecnológica e impulsionar sua competitividade no mercado.